SiT8208
Ultra Performance Oscillator
The Smart Timing Choice
The Smart Timing Choice
Features
Applications
Any frequency between 1 and 80 MHz accurate to 6 decimal places
100% pin-to-pin drop-in replacement to quartz-based oscillators
Ultra low phase jitter: 0.5 ps (12 kHz to 20 MHz)
Frequency stability as low as ±10 PPM
Industrial or extended commercial temperature range
LVCMOS/LVTTL compatible output
Standard 4-pin packages: 2.5 x 2.0, 3.2 x 2.5, 5.0 x 3.2,
7.0 x 5.0 mm x mm
Instant samples with
Time Machine II
and
field programmable
oscillators
Outstanding silicon reliability of 2 FIT or 500 million hour MTBF
Pb-free, RoHS and REACH compliant
Ultra short lead time
SATA, SAS, Ethernet, PCI Express, video, WiFi
Computing, storage, networking, telecom, industrial control
